C51单片机实战100例.docVIP

  • 75
  • 0
  • 约2.21万字
  • 约 50页
  • 2021-12-10 发布于山东
  • 举报
C51单片机实战100例 C51单片机实战100例 PAGE / NUMPAGES C51单片机实战100例 . 目录 目录 1 函数的使用和熟悉 6 实例 3 :用单片机控制第一个灯亮 7 实例 4 :用单片机控制一个灯闪烁:认识单片机的工作频率 7 实例 5 :将 P1 口状态分别送入 P0 、 P2 、 P3 口:认识 I/O 口的引脚功能 8 ... . 实例 6 :使用 P3 口流水点亮 8 位 LED 9 实例 7 :通过对 P3 口地址的操作流水点亮 8位LED 11 实例 8 :用不同数据类型控制灯闪烁时间 13 实例 9 :用 P0 口、 P1 口分别显示加法和减法运算结果 1 5 实例 10 :用 P0 、P1 口显示乘法运算结果 15 实例 11 :用 P1 、P0 口显示除法运算结果 17 实例 12 :用自增运算控制 P0 口 8 位 LED 流水花样 17 实例 13 :用 P0 口显示逻辑 与 运算结果 18 实例 14 :用 P0 口显示条件运算结果 19 实例 15 :用 P0 口显示按位 异或 运算结果19 实例 16 :用 P0 显示左移运算结果 19 实例 17 : 万能逻辑电路 实验 20 实例 18 :用右移运算流水点亮 P1 口 8 位 LED 20 实例 19 :用 if 语句控制 P0 口 8 位 LED 的流水方向 22 实例 20 :用 swtich 语句的控制 P0 口 8 位 LED 的点亮状态23 实例 21 :用 for 语句控制蜂鸣器鸣笛次数 25 实例 22 :用 while 语句控制 LED 27 实例 23 :用 do-while 语句控制 P0 口 8 位 LED 流水点亮 29 实例 24 :用字符型数组控制 P0 口 8 位 LED 流水点亮 30 实例 25:用 P0 口显示字符串常量 32 实例 26 :用 P0 口显示指针运算结果 33 实例 27 :用指针数组控制 P0 口 8 位 LED 流水点亮 34 ... . 实例 28 :用数组的指针控制 P0 口 8 位 LED 流水点亮 36 实例 29 :用 P0 、P1 口显示整型函数返回值37 实例 30 :用有参函数控制 P0 口 8 位 LED 流水速度 38 实例 31 :用数组作函数参数控制流水花样 40 实例 32 :用指针作函数参数控制 P0 口 8 位 LED 流水点亮 42 实例 33 :用函数型指针控制 P1 口灯花样 44 实例 34 :用指针数组作为函数的参数显示多个字符串 46 实例 35 :字符函数 ctype.h 应用举例 48 实例 36 :内部函数 intrins.h 应用举例 49 实例 37 :标准函数 stdlib.h 应用举例 50 实例 38 :字符串函数 string.h 应用举例 51 实例 39 :宏定义应用举例 2 52 实例 40 :宏定义应用举例 2 53 实例 41 :宏定义应用举例 3 54 中断、定时器 55 实例 42 :用定时器 T0 查询方式 P2 口 8 位控制 LED 闪烁 55 实例 43 :用定时器 T1 查询方式控制单片机发出 1KHz 音频 56 实例 44 :将计数器 T0 计数的结果送 P1 口8位LED显示 57 实例 45 :用定时器 T0 的中断控制 1 位 LED 闪烁 58 实例 46 :用定时器 T0 的中断实现长时间定时 60 实例 47 :用定时器 T1 中断控制两个 LED 以不同周期闪烁 61 实例 48 :用计数器 T1 的中断控制蜂鸣器发出 1KHz 音频 63 ... . 实例 49 :用定时器 T0 的中断实现 渴望 主题曲的播放 65 实例 50-1 :输出 50 个矩形脉冲 70 实例 50-2 :计数器 T0 统计外部脉冲数 72 实例 51-2 :定时器 T0 的模式 2 测量正脉冲宽度 72 实例 52 :用定时器 T0 控制输出高低宽度不同的矩形波 74 实例 53 :用外中断 0 的中断方式进行数据采集 76 实例 54-1 :输出负脉宽为 200 微秒的方波 77 实例 54-2 :测量负脉冲宽度 78 实例 55 :方式 0 控制流水灯循环点亮 80 实例 56-1 :数据发送程序 82 实例 56-2 :数据接收程序 84 实例 57-1 :数据发送程序 85 实例 57-2 :数据接收程序 88 实例 58 :单片机向 PC 发送数据 89 实例 59 :单片机接收 PC 发出的数据 92 数码管显示 93 实例 60 :用 LED 数码显示数

文档评论(0)

1亿VIP精品文档

相关文档